We've been trying to install some TotLocks on our cabinets today, and the magnet doesn't seem to be strong enough to unlock the cabinet. Our cabinets are far less thick than what the package says the manget will go through, but we aren't having much luck. Has anyone else here had this problem? I bought these for two reasons...1) they got great reviews here and 2)our cabinets don't have knobs or pulls.

Are there any other alternatives for cabinets without knobs or pulls?

There are two things I can think of to try. Be sure you installed the locks EXACTLY as it says on the package. We had trouble with one lock that my DH tried to "freestyle". Also, you might try pushing the cabinet door closed when you use the magnet to unlock it. Some cabinet doors have the little foam things (inside the door corners) to keep them from making a slamming noise, and this can prevent the magnet from unlocking correctly. We actually have removed a bunch of these and the Tot locks work better.

Also, when you unlock the door the magnet has to be in EXACTLY the right place. Move the key around slowly in a circle until you hear the click.

We had this problem too and had to remove all the little protector things in order for the Totloks to work. I also have a few cabinets that I need to push in, in order to get the Totlok to work.
